The dissertation addresses the limitations of traditional relational query interfaces in sensor networks (SN), particularly for tracking object movement in applications like wildlife observation and traffic monitoring. It highlights the inadequacies of Moving Object Databases (MOD) in this context due to SN's unique challenges, such as node failures and imprecise spatial knowledge. By defining a comprehensive set of spatio-temporal operators tailored for SN, the work presents an innovative distributed and energy-efficient query processor that enhances query capabilities in these networks.
